When considering combining allergy medication with Advil, it is crucial to be cautious due to potential interactions and adverse effects. Always consult with a healthcare provider before taking any new medications, especially if you have known allergies or medical conditions. Advil, a brand name for ibuprofen, is a nonsteroidal anti-inflammatory drug (NSAID) commonly used for pain relief and reducing inflammation. It is essential to be aware of the risks associated with NSAIDs and allergies, as some individuals may be allergic to these medications. If you have a history of medication allergies, it is crucial to inform your healthcare provider before starting any new medications, including over-the-counter products like Advil. To ensure your safety and well-being, seek guidance from a healthcare professional who can provide personalized advice based on your specific health needs and medical history.
